UK Gambling Commission Appoints Sue Young as Executive Director of Operations
Wednesday 18 de March 2026 / 12:00
⏱ 2 min read
(London).- Former HMRC director brings extensive public sector leadership to strengthen regulatory oversight and safer gambling initiatives
The UK Gambling Commission has announced the appointment of Sue Young as its new Executive Director of Operations, reinforcing its leadership team as it advances efforts to ensure a safer and more transparent gambling environment.
Sue Young joins the regulator from HM Revenue and Customs (HMRC), where she served as Director of Debt Management. She brings a wealth of senior leadership experience across the public sector, having held key roles within the Home Office, including positions in Border Force, as well as at HM Inspectorate of Constabulary and Fire & Rescue Services and the Department of Health and Social Care.
In her new role, Young will oversee a range of the Commission’s operational functions, playing a central role in strengthening regulatory enforcement and supporting the organization’s mission to keep gambling fair, safe, and free from criminal activity.
The appointment comes at a time when the Gambling Commission continues to expand its regulatory focus, with increased emphasis on compliance, consumer protection, and industry accountability across the UK gambling sector.
Sarah Gardner, Acting Chief Executive, said: “I’m delighted to welcome Sue to the Gambling Commission. There is a great deal of important work underway across our operational teams, not least our continued focus on tackling the illegal market and delivering strong regulatory outcomes. Sue brings a wealth of operational leadership experience and I’m very much looking forward to working with her.”
Sue Young said: “I’m excited to be joining the Gambling Commission and to be learning about a new sector. The Commission plays an important role in protecting consumers and ensuring gambling is conducted fairly and safely. I’m looking forward to building on the significant work already underway across the organisation.”
